510,896 is a composite number, even.
510,896 (five hundred ten thousand eight hundred ninety-six) is an even 6-digit number. It is a composite number with 20 divisors, and factors as 2⁴ × 37 × 863. Written other ways, in hexadecimal, 0x7CBB0.
